Rigorous Testing by Certified Laboratories

Before any medical cannabis product reaches our shelves, it undergoes comprehensive testing by Certified Marijuana Testing Laboratories (CMTLs) approved by the Florida Department of Health’s Office of Medical Marijuana Use (OMMU). These laboratories are accredited under ISO/IEC 17025:2017, ensuring they meet international standards for testing accuracy and reliability.

The testing process includes:​

  • Potency Analysis: Verifying the concentrations of cannabinoids like THC and CBD to ensure they match the product’s labeling.​
  • Contaminant Screening: Detecting harmful substances such as heavy metals, pesticides, residual solvents, and microbial contaminants.​
  • Moisture and Water Activity Testing: Assessing these parameters to prevent mold growth and ensure product stability.

Only products that pass all these tests receive a Certificate of Analysis (COA), a document detailing the test results and confirming the product’s safety and quality.​


Strict Manufacturing and Processing Standards

Medical Marijuana Treatment Centers (MMTCs), which oversee cultivation, processing, and dispensing, must adhere to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P). Within 12 months of licensure, MMTCs are required to pass a Food Safety GMP inspection by a nationally accredited certifying body.​

These standards ensure:​

  • Sanitary Facilities: Maintaining clean and hygienic environments to prevent contamination.​
  • Trained Personnel: Ensuring staff are adequately trained in safety and quality protocols.​
  • Controlled Processes: Implementing standardized procedures for production and quality control.​

For edible products, MMTCs must also comply with the Florida Food Safety Act, ensuring that these items meet the same safety standards as conventional food products.​


Comprehensive Security and Tracking Measures

To maintain product integrity and prevent diversion, Florida mandates robust security protocols for all MMTC facilities. These include:​

  • 24/7 Video Surveillance: Monitoring all areas where cannabis is cultivated, processed, or stored.​
  • Access Controls: Restricting facility access to authorized personnel only.​
  • Inventory Tracking: Utilizing a seed-to-sale tracking system to monitor products throughout the supply chain.​

These measures ensure that all products are accounted for and have not been tampered with, providing an additional layer of consumer protection.​


Ensuring Product Freshness

Maintaining the freshness of cannabis products is crucial for efficacy and safety. MMTCs employ several strategies to ensure this:​

  • Controlled Storage Conditions: Storing products in environments with regulated temperature and humidity to preserve potency and prevent degradation.​
  • Regular Quality Checks: Conducting periodic inspections to assess product condition and remove any items that no longer meet quality standards.​
  • Efficient Inventory Management: Implementing systems to rotate stock effectively, ensuring that older products are dispensed before newer ones.​

These practices help guarantee that the products you receive are as fresh and effective as intended.​
